当前位置:首页 > 系统教程 > 正文

万众创芯:一个人完成芯片全流程指南

万众创芯:一个人完成芯片全流程指南

从设计到点亮Linux的详细教程

在这个教程中,我们将一步步教你如何一个人从零开始设计芯片,经过流片、制作PCB板卡,最终点亮Linux系统。即使你是小白,也能跟着学懂。整个过程涉及芯片设计流片PCB布局Linux系统移植,这些都是现代电子开发的核心技术。

第一步:芯片设计基础

芯片设计是整个过程的开端。你需要学习硬件描述语言如Verilog或VHDL,并使用EDA工具(如Xilinx Vivado或Intel Quartus)进行设计。从简单的逻辑门开始,逐步构建复杂功能模块。确保设计符合规范,并通过仿真验证功能正确性。这部分是芯片设计的关键,它为后续流片打下基础。

第二步:流片过程详解

流片是将设计好的芯片图案送到晶圆厂生产的过程。首先,将设计文件转换为GDSII格式,然后选择晶圆厂(如TSMC或SMIC)进行制造。流片涉及光刻、蚀刻等工艺,成本较高,因此需要仔细检查设计以避免错误。这一步确保了芯片的物理实现,是流片的核心环节。

第三步:PCB板卡设计与制作

万众创芯:一个人完成芯片全流程指南 芯片设计 流片 PCB布局 Linux系统移植 第1张

PCB板卡是将芯片集成到电路中的载体。使用EDA工具(如KiCad或Altium Designer)进行PCB布局,包括元件放置、布线、层叠设计等。确保信号完整性和电源稳定性。设计完成后,将文件发送给PCB制造商生产板卡,然后焊接芯片和其他元件。这部分是硬件集成的关键,为点亮Linux提供平台。

第四步:点亮Linux:系统移植与启动

点亮Linux意味着在自制芯片上运行Linux操作系统。这需要Linux系统移植:首先,配置引导程序(如U-Boot)以初始化硬件;然后,编译Linux内核,适配设备树文件;最后,制作根文件系统。通过串口或网络连接,将系统镜像加载到板卡上,并观察启动日志。成功启动后,你就完成了从芯片到系统的全流程!

总结:通过这个教程,你学会了如何一个人完成芯片设计、流片、PCB板卡制作和点亮Linux。这不仅是技术挑战,更是创新精神的体现。希望你能在实践中深化对芯片设计Linux系统移植的理解,推动万众创芯的梦想!